Igor Kunitsyn defeated Marat Safin 7-6 6-7 6-3 in the Moscow final on hard. The upset overturned the form book — Marat Safin came in leading the head-to-head 3–0, defending last year's round of 16. Igor Kunitsyn claimed a first win over Marat Safin in four meetings, narrowing the head-to-head to 3–1.
